Gr 2-5-These books introduce language concepts using common topics to clearly model them. Each spread contains an "On the Write Track" text box that gives more information or additional examples. For example, Sentences explains that, "An incomplete sentence is called a fragment." Conjunctions states that, "Dependent clauses act like a noun, adjective, or adverb in a sentence." On each spread, large, stock photos on the right page are relevant to the facts presented on the left. Diagrams and charts will help readers grasp the information. Children will be drawn to the clean layout and well-presented subject matter. Grades 5 & Upα(c) Copyright 2013. Library Journal. LLC, a wholly owned subsidiary of Media Source, Inc.
